Special features regarding teaching

In Braunschweig, theory, pharmaceutical practice and science are closely linked. Even during their studies, students synthesise and analyse medicinal substances, identify medicinal plants and produce medicinal products. The practice of drug therapies is studied in the training pharmacy and in cooperation with the hospital. Only in Braunschweig is there the interdisciplinary programme "PhaNetzt", in which students work on scientific topics over four semesters. A highlight of the course is the afternoon of research, where students present the results of their own research.

Special features regarding the international orientation

In Braunschweig there are excellent opportunities for stays abroad during studies at eight European universities in seven countries (Belgium, Denmark, France, the Netherlands, Norway, Slovenia, Spain) within the framework of Erasmus cooperation. There are worldwide exchanges for students, doctoral candidates and lecturers with universities and research institutions in numerous countries, including Great Britain, France, Sweden, the USA, Japan, China and New Zealand. Students regularly report on their international research stays at the Afternoon of Research.

Special features regarding the equipment

Due to the close cooperation with the Centre for Pharmaceutical Process Engineering, excellent equipment is available, e.g. for investigations on tissue constructs to save animal experiments. In addition, there is sophisticated equipment for imaging and high-resolution processes, cell culture laboratories and drug formulation pilot plants. The Fachinformationsdienst Pharmazie provides licenses of pharmaceutical literature and databases, operates the platform PubPharm with more than 55 million publications and provides numerous pharmaceutical textbooks as e-books.

Special features regarding research activities

Braunschweig is a centre of molecular drug research and drug development. Current projects concern drug design and analytics, biologically produced drugs and nanostructured drug carriers. Important projects are underway on drugs for specific diseases (cardiovascular, diabetes, cancer, infections). In addition, there are pharmaceutical history topics and alternatives to animal testing. Close cooperation partners are the Centre for Pharmaceutical Process Engineering, the Helmholtz Centre for Infection Research as well as international companies and research organisations.

Support for founders

Start-ups are intensively promoted by the TU Braunschweig. The Technology Transfer Office helps to find contacts within the TU Braunschweig as well as to companies and research institutions. It supports inventors in marketing their research results and provides assistance in setting up companies. The cooperation of the TU Braunschweig with the Innovationsgesellschaft Technische Universität Braunschweig mbH (iTUBS) ensures a commercial knowledge and technology transfer with as few administrative hurdles as possible.
